Located around 5 minutes' walk from Kazmierz The Former Jewish District, the 3-star Kolory Guest House Krakow provides guided tour service for the utmost comfort and convenience. This smoke-free bed & breakfast lies in Old Town with quick access to John Paul II International Krakow-Balice airport, just a short stroll from such cultural sights as Ethnographic Museum.
All of the air-conditioned rooms are appointed with free Wi-Fi and a satellite TV along with a coffee machine, and some of them include a balcony and a sitting area. Also, they feature parquetry flooring. The private bathrooms are appointed with hairdryers and bath sheets.
Situated within a short walking distance of this Krakow hotel, the quick bites Sami Am Am offers a Middle Eastern menu.
The property is in the very heart of Krakow, nearly 5 minutes' walk from the restored Old Synagogue and within 15 minutes' walk of Wawel Royal Castle. The Kolory Guest House Krakow is approximately 5 minutes' walk from Swietego Wawrzynca bus stop and only a few metres from Corpus Christi Basilica. The high-tech subterranean Rynek Underground Museum is 19 minutes on foot from the accommodation. For those travelling from afar, John Paul II International Krakow-Balice airport is 21 minutes' drive away.
